10 Great Walking Tours Through the Most Colorful Neighborhoods in Chicago Follow Frommer's for an up-close-and-personal look at Chicago. Discover the landmark architecture, ethnic neighborhoods, historic homes, and spectacular lakefront that make the Second City second to none. LET FROMMER'S TAKE YOU TO: The Loop, an open-air showroom of architectural innovation and contemporary sculpture, from the Sears Tower to works by Picasso, Calder, and Miro The Magnificent Mile, lined with sleek skyscrapers and elegant shopping centers The glittering Gold Coast, a tree-shaded stretch of historic homes along Lake Michigan Oak Park, home to Frank Lloyd Wright's early architectural achievements With easy-to-use directions and maps-and the best places to take a break along the way
